Course Overview

Nutrition MSc/PG Dip, King's College London Intensive conversion programme primarily for graduates in biological sciences or medicine. Gain a broad knowledge and understanding of nutrition and develop your scientific skills to graduate level. Includes taught modules and a research project. Leads to careers in nutrition planning, health promotion, nutrition information, teaching or research. KEY BENEFITS: Well-established, broad-based conversion course covering all aspects of nutrition, Taught in a research-led environment by staff who are experts in a wide variety of specialities, An excellent stepping stone to nutrition planning, teaching or research in the health and education services, government or the food industry, Located in the heart of London. PURPOSE: The MSc is an intensive conversion programme intended primarily for graduates in biological sciences or medicine. The PG Dip is appropriate for those who wish to study for a shorter period than the MSc, including those who need to update their knowledge and do not wish to undertake a research project. Both aim to provide you with a broad knowledge and understanding of nutrition and to develop your scientific skills to graduate level. DESCRIPTIONMSc and PG Dip: The principles of nutrition, public health nutrition, clinical nutrition and nutrition research skills. From May to August MSc students undertake a supervised research project. Core modules: Principles of Nutrition; Public Health Nutrition; Clinical Nutrition; Nutrition Research Skills; MSc Nutrition Project.
